A solid state relay (SSR) is an electronic switching device that switches on or off when an external voltage (AC or DC) is applied across its control terminals. It serves the same function as an electromechanical relay, but has no moving parts and therefore results in a longer operational lifetime. SSRs consist of a sensor which responds to an appropriate input (control signal), a solid-state electronic switching device which switches power to the load circuitry, and a coupling mechanism to enable the control signal to activate this switch without mechanical parts. The relay may be designed to switch either AC or DC loads.

This 5V 1 Channel Solid State Relay Module is capable of switching AC voltages between 100 and 240V at up to a 2A current. The module can be controlled from a 5V digital source such as an Arduino microcontroller, 8051, PIC, etc.

Technical Specification:

  • Voltage: 5V
  • Working Current: 5mA
  • Trigger voltage(V): 0V to 1.5V
  • Trigger current(mA): 2mA
  • Load: 2A @240V AC
  • Size: 25mm*34mmm*25mm (L*W*H)

Features:

  • Compact size
  • Totally silent operation
  • Led indicator for each relay
  • Fast switching speed
  • Longer lifespan
  • Inbuilt resistive fuse to protect from the excessive current drain
  • Can be controlled directly by Arduino or other microcontrollers
